正文
oracle取前一天数据函数,oracle取当前日期前一年
小程序:扫一扫查出行
【扫一扫了解最新限行尾号】
复制小程序
【扫一扫了解最新限行尾号】
复制小程序
oracle中怎样获取当前月上个月的第一天和最后一天?
1、试试下面语句:当天日期小于7月时取当年的第一天,当天日期大于6月时取7月的第一天。
2、select trunc(sysdate,DD)-to_char(sysdate,D)+8-(to_number(to_char(sysdate,IW))-&week)*7 from dual;补充完整某年的第几周的第1天和最后一天。
3、正解:select add_months(last_day(hiredate),1)from dual;Add_months(d,n)当前日期d后推n个月 用于从一个日期值增加或减少一些月份 Last_day 本月最后一天 hiredate你需要指定的日期。
4、假如你的表是table (trx_date date, value number);select trx_date,value-lead(value) over (order by trx_date desc) from table.这样就可以了。
5、不会用函数吗? 其实你就是想查去年1月到去年今天的语句吧?一看就知道是想算同比了。
6、甲骨文股份有限公司(Oracle)是全球大型数据库软件公司,总部位于美国加州红木城的红木岸。在2008年,甲骨文股份有限公司是继Microsoft及IBM后,全球收入第三多的软件公司。
ORACLE查询前一天22点到今天22点的数据
where date sysdate()估计你用的是pl sql了,如果是的话,结束时加“;”。
可以使用to_char()、concat()等函数实现查询前一小时、前一天、前一个月或者前一年的数据。
你可以建个视图,create view as select *,to_char(datatime,yy-mm-dd hh24)as 时间段 from a,然后用这个时间段做统计查询。
oracle中定时器是如何用的上网查 declare jobno number;begin dbms_job.submit(jobno,begin 查询语句; end;,trunc(sysdate)+1,trunc(sysdate)+1);end;这里第一个参数是任务编号,系统自动赋值。
oracle取前几条数据语句
在Oracle中实现SELECT TOP N : 由于ORACLE不支持SELECT TOP语句,所以在ORACLE中经常是用ORDER BY跟ROWNUM的组合来实现SELECT TOP N的查询。
首先在oracle软件中,可以使用下面的 SELECT 语句:(其中%就是通配符,标识表达式=1个字符)。使用其他的通配符的SQL语句如下图示。使用全通配符,就可以实现一个字符串是否包含包含某个字符串的查找了。
我们在Oracle中常用的就是order by,然后取得rownum小于多少的数据这种方法。
Oracle数据库实现获取前几条数据的方法
在Oracle中实现SELECT TOP N : 由于ORACLE不支持SELECT TOP语句,所以在ORACLE中经常是用ORDER BY跟ROWNUM的组合来实现SELECT TOP N的查询。
首先在oracle软件中,可以使用下面的 SELECT 语句:(其中%就是通配符,标识表达式=1个字符)。使用其他的通配符的SQL语句如下图示。使用全通配符,就可以实现一个字符串是否包含包含某个字符串的查找了。
我们在Oracle中常用的就是order by,然后取得rownum小于多少的数据这种方法。
oracle按小时查询显示数据
1、select 号码,count(1)from 表 where 时间 = concat(to_char(sysdate,yyyy-mm-dd )||(to_char(sysdate,hh24)-1),:00:00)group by 号码 一个小时内的。
2、你那日期格式错了,分钟不是mm,是mi;确定你8点到10点之间,这两头的时间点是开区间、闭区间还是半开半闭区间。
3、按小时的话,就很省事 直接 GROUP BY TO_CHAR(datetime , YYYY-MM-DD HH24) 就好。要30分钟的话……要尝试用 CASE WHEN , 或者 自己写个函数了。
4、打开常用PLSQL Developer工具,输入登录信息。如图所示:完成以上操作后,要在工具中新建SQL窗口,如图:打开新建SQL的窗口,打开是空白是正常情况。
5、你可以建个视图,create view as select *,to_char(datatime,yy-mm-dd hh24)as 时间段 from a,然后用这个时间段做统计查询。
关于oracle取前一天数据函数和oracle取当前日期前一年的介绍到此就结束了,不知道你从中找到你需要的信息了吗 ?如果你还想了解更多这方面的信息,记得收藏关注本站。